Vanishing viscosity limits for axisymmetric flows with boundary
arXiv:1806.04811
Abstract
We construct global weak solutions of the Euler equations in an infinite cylinder for axisymmetric initial data without swirl when initial vorticity satisfies for . The solutions constructed are Hölder continuous for spatial variables in if in addition that for and unique if . The proof is by a vanishing viscosity method. We show that the Navier-Stokes equations subject to the Neumann boundary condition is globally well-posed for axisymmetric data without swirl in for all . It is also shown that the energy dissipation tends to zero if for , and Navier-Stokes flows converge to Euler flow in locally uniformly for if additionally . The -convergence in particular implies the energy equality for weak solutions.
